Statistics released by the American Society of Plastic Surgery (ASPS) for 2012 revealed that breast augmentation (286,000, down 7% from 2011) was the most popular cosmetic surgery. Rhinoplasty (nose job) was second (243,000, unchanged), blepharoplasty (eyelid surgery) third (204,000, up 4%), liposuction forth (202,000 down 2%), followed by facelifts (126,000, up 6%). It is thought that with baby boomers now at the age for facial rejuvenation that there will be increased demand for face lifts, neck lifts, and blepharoplasty.
